truncate FILEHANDLE, LENGTH |
截斷(減少)FILEHANDLE到指定的長度(以字節為單位)指定的文件的大小。如果您的係統上未實現的功能,會產生一個致命的錯誤。
undef - 如果操作失敗
1 - 成功
下麵的例子將截斷零長度文件“test.txt”。
#!/usr/bin/perl -w
#by www.gitbook.net
open( FILE, "</tmp/test.txt" ) || die "Enable to open test file";
truncate( FILE, 0 );
close(FILE);